Dolphins Ground The Jets
In a game that stared out slow, the Dolphins defense and special teams came up big in the 2nd half of the 30-25 win over the Jets.  This marks the 2nd win for the Fins over the Jets this season and completes the season sweep.   By the second quarter of the game, each team had scored just one field goal a piece.  But in the 3rd quarter, the Fins explosion was led by an unlikely source; Ted Ginn Jr.  Ginn has not produced well or lived up to his expectations this year,

Looking Ahead
The New Orleans Saints are up next for the Miami Dolphins and this will be an epic challenge for this young team.  The Saints walked, ran and stomped all over the previously undefeated New York Giants yesterday by a score of 48-27.  The Saints offensive assault, led by Drew Brees, has been incredible.  And the Dolphins defense this year, especially against the pass, has not been great.
